History of Slot Machines

The roots of slot machines wind back to the late 19th century, with the birth of the Liberty Bell in 1895. Charles Fey, the inventor, designed this machine featuring three spinning reels and five symbols, including the iconic Liberty Bell. This marked the dawn of an era where chance met design.

With time, these mechanical devices evolved into digital systems, embracing more elaborate graphics and engaging sound effects. The transition from physical levers to touchscreens in modern times shows how technology has interwoven with this form of gambling. This evolution has not only increased accessibility but also diversified gameplay, catering to differing preferences.

How Slot Machines Work

At the heart of every slot machine is a random number generator (RNG). This technology ensures that results are unpredictable and fair, allowing for truly random outcomes. Players often think that timing or strategy based on recent outcomes could influence their luck, but in reality, each spin is independent of the last. Understanding this mechanic is essential as it can reshape a player's expectations.

Return to Player (RTP) Explained

Return to Player, or RTP, represents the percentage of wagered money that a slot machine is expected to pay back to players over time. For instance, if a game has an RTP of 96%, it will return an average of $96 for every $100 wagered. However, this is calculated over thousands of spins, meaning individual experiences can vary significantly.

High RTP slots are usually more appealing to players. Yet, RTP values might not always be readily available on the casino floor. Hence, players should do their homework before sitting down at a machine.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Check Game Information: Most online casinos provide RTP stats in the game details.
  • Higher RTP is Better: Slots with higher RTPs provide a better chance at winning long term.
  • Consider Volatility: Sometimes, games with high RTPs may have lower payouts on average, depending on the volatility.

House Edge in Slot Games

House edge is another crucial aspect every player should comprehend. It represents the casino's advantage over the player. It is calculated based on the game's RTP. For example, if a slot has an RTP of 95%, the house edge is 5%. This doesn't mean that players cannot win; rather, it depicts the long-term profitability for casinos at a given game.

Understanding the house edge allows players to manage expectations. While it’s possible to walk away a winner, over time the odds will statistically favor the house. Players should take this into account, especially when strategizing their bankroll management and gaming sessions.

Understanding Volatility

The concept of volatility in slots cannot be overstated. It refers to the risk associated with a particular slot machine. High volatility slots can lead to substantial wins, but they may also produce dry spells. Conversely, low volatility slots tend to deliver regular, albeit smaller, payouts. Understanding your own risk tolerance is crucial in this process. Are you someone who can handle the emotional rollercoaster of infrequent wins, or do you prefer the steadiness of frequent, smaller rewards?

Knowing these personal preferences will greatly influence your decisions regarding which machines to play and how to structure your overall strategy. Emotional Triggers and Gambling

Gambling, especially in slot games, stirs a range of emotions, from excitement and anticipation to anxiety and despair. These emotional triggers can be incredibly powerful. For instance, the rush experienced when a player hits a jackpot, albeit a small one, releases dopamine in the brain, mimicking feelings of pleasure and satisfaction. This biochemical cocktail compels players to chase that high, often leading them back for more spins.

Some emotions can cloud judgment. The thrill of near-misses—where symbols almost align—creates a false sense of hope. It’s as though the machine is hinting at a win just around the corner. Players might increase their betting during these moments, thinking a big win is imminent. Recognizing these emotional triggers is essential for players to manage their feelings and gameplay effectively.

Myths About Winning Streaks

One persistent myth involves the idea of winning streaks. Many players believe that after a series of consecutive wins, a machine is 'due' for a loss—that somehow, a payout is owed. But the truth is, this notion has no grounding in the mechanics of how slot machines operate. The probability of winning remains unchanged with each spin. Every spin is independent, driven by the random number generator. There’s no cosmic ledger keeping track of previous outcomes.

Key Points:

  • Each spin is separate and random.
  • Long winning streaks do not influence future outcomes.
  • Believing in "due" payouts can lead to overestimating chances of winning.

The Truth About Hot and Cold Machines

The notion of hot and cold machines is another prevalent myth. A common belief is that certain machines are more likely to pay out (hot machines) or less likely to pay out (cold machines). Players might start developing a fixation on these so-called hot slots and avoid others, thinking they're on the losing end. The fact is, this concept is largely psychological. Every machine has the same statistical chance of hitting a jackpot, regardless of what players believe. Casino operators have no control over which machines will perform better or worse at any given time.

Considerations:

  • The concept of hot and cold machines lacks factual support.
  • All machines operate randomly, independent of one another.
  • Player perceptions can lead to biased selection but may not improve odds.
